LucasFilm VS Digg Community

Thursday, February 22nd, 2007

LucasFilm has filed a trademark infringement suit against Digg.com, citing that the popular social news site is too similar in name to “The Dig”– a video game first released by the Lucas owned entertainment company in 1994.

LucasFilm claims that Digg is identical or nearly identical to The Dig and is confusingly similar in sound, meaning, and appearance, which likely will create confusion, mistake or deception in the minds of prospective purchasers as to the origin of The Dig.

Digger Maxwell Lamb, however, disagrees:

“Lucasfilm no longer cares about ‘The Dig’ trademark, as the brand is obsolete and no longer relevant to their business or their merchandising. They have filed what they know to be a frivolous suit with a view to Digg winning with ease, thus setting a precedent for the prevalence of their trademark.”

So, It appears that it’s going take more than a mere Jedi mind trick to convince the Digg community of the validity surrounding LucasFilm’s opposition to the trademark.
